Transaction 6e70707798b4ac8c9c5d9133b6775ef899eb8a6812435155a346225b3e929936

1 Input
2 Outputs
  • 6e70707798b4ac8c9c5d9133b6775ef899eb8a6812435155a346225b3e929936:0
  • value  620000
    address  33vwRFdBCt58TDVkDewRKGaCA5UV9ubzpG
  • 6e70707798b4ac8c9c5d9133b6775ef899eb8a6812435155a346225b3e929936:1
  • value  1631347
    address  37KS14DxbL59iNU47Ad2oR7GRWHSFGK75Y